Avenue of the Arts is available for wedding ceremonies, receptions, and other special events. The venue has a maximum capacity of 218 guests and comprises both indoor and outdoor event spaces. These include the Grand Ballroom and the picturesque Lakeside Lawn. Overnight accommodation is also available for you and your guests. Standard and deluxe rooms and luxury suites are available. Couples can enjoy a complimentary Deluxe Honeymoon suite, plus champagne, chocolate-dipped strawberries, and a post-wedding breakfast.
Avenue of the Arts offers five-star service and flexible packaging options. Wedding package features and options include planning assistance, event catering, shuttle service, and much more.
